Skip to main content
Subscribe
Register
Sign in
Membership
Insights
Events
About
Subscribe
Register
Sign in
Mercuria Energy Group
Latest Articles
Banks’ Exit from the Commodities Business Could Spell Market Woes
Aaron Timms